Synergistic effect of tetrapropylammonium hydroxide and urea on hemicellulose fractionation with high-purity and high molecular weight
Key Points
High-purity hemicellulose with improved molecular weight is achievable using a combination of urea and tetrapropylammonium hydroxide.
Fractionation results show that the combined use effectively enhances yields by 30% in comparison to singular methods.
Observational analysis of hemicellulose extraction across multiple trials demonstrates the robustness of this combination in achieving high-purity levels.
Future applications may enable more efficient biofuel production processes, highlighting the significance of hemicellulose as a renewable resource.
